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
While the list of prohibited items can differ between airlines, the general rule to follow is nothing fl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, drills, fuels and bleaching agents. Sports equipment like ski poles, and objects that could harm passengers, such as guns and swords, won't be allowed on board either.
What to wear on a flight:
Go for comfort over style. Prepare for changes in cabin temperature by donning layers, and pick slightly roomy, flat footwear like slip-ons.
Most of us have he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by long periods of inactivity. To lessen your risk on board, stay hydrated, consider wearing compression socks or tights and keep your legs and feet moving.
How to get through airport security fast when flying to Sainte Marie?
It's easy — be prepared. We've compiled some handy tips and tricks for an easy trip through security. Watch out Sainte Marie, here you come:
Keep your passport and travel documents within close reach. They're the first things you'll be asked to present to security.
The X-ray machine comes next. Remove anything metal on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like earphones or headph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
Your electronic gadgets like phones and laptops will also need to go on a tray to be scanned. No need to wor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
Travelling with your favourite perfume? As long as the volume is no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-close bag, you're allowed to bring it with you in your carry-on bag.
Slip-on shoes are a practical footwear choice as you're less likely to be asked to remove them when going through security. Big boots and other heavy-style shoes are often subjected to extra screening.
Airlines will not allow any sharp items or pocket knives in your hand lu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ked baggage.
